CFP: New and Emerging Research in Political Geography
This session provides a space for postgraduate students undertaking research in Political Geography to present at a major conference in a supportive and relaxed setting. Our intention is to foster an environment where connections between Masters and PhD students and the wider Political Geography community can be made.
We welcome papers that discuss initial research aims/design, engage with methodological and/or theoretical questions, or that draw upon empirical findings. There is no chronological or geographical limit to papers and postgraduates can be at any stage of their research.
The sessions will be designed to encourage audience questions, as well as the sharing of experience and advice. This session will demonstrate the vibrancy of postgraduate contributions to Political Geography and will held in a supportive and inclusive space.
